Another stabilized generator model for three phase sinewaves
B.Z. Kaplan and
D. Kottick
Mathematics and Computers in Simulation (MATCOM), 1981, vol. 23, issue 3, 277-279
Abstract:
A new three dimensional oscillator for generating three phases of sinewaves is derived. The model is similar to the previous ones (Ref. 1 and 2) in enabling an undistorted stabilized generation of sinewaves. It possesses certain advantages in comparison to the previous models. The oscillator appears as a viable model for representing synchronous generators in a simplified manner in the simulation of power systems.
